Oven Baked Salmon with a Tangy Glaze

Ingredients

  • 2 lbs fresh salmon fillet
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/8 tsp sugar
  • 1/8 tsp ground black pepper
  • 1/8 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/8 tsp paprika
  • 1/3 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 lemon, thinly sliced

Instructions

  1. Preheat the Oven:
    Preheat your oven to 350˚F (175˚C). Line a large rimmed baking sheet with parchment paper for easy cleanup.
  2. Prepare the Seasoning Mix:
    In a small bowl, combine the salt, sugar, black pepper, garlic powder, and paprika. Stir well to blend the flavors.
  3. Season the Salmon:
    Place the salmon fillet skin-side down on the prepared baking sheet. Evenly sprinkle the seasoning mix over the top of the salmon.
  4. Apply the Mayo Glaze:
    Spread a thin, even layer of mayonnaise over the seasoned salmon. A light coating is sufficient for flavor and moisture.
  5. Add Lemon Slices:
    Arrange the lemon slices over the top of the salmon for a bright, tangy flavor and attractive presentation.
  6. Bake the Salmon:
    Cover the salmon loosely with foil and bake in the preheated oven for 20 minutes.
  7. Broil for a Golden Finish:
    Remove the foil and switch your oven to the broil setting. Broil the salmon for an additional 2-3 minutes, or until the top turns golden and slightly caramelized.
  8. Serve:
    Remove the salmon from the oven and let it rest for 5 minutes before serving. Enjoy your tender, flavorful salmon with your favorite side dishes.

Tips

  • Ensure the salmon is evenly seasoned for balanced flavor.
  • Use a meat thermometer to ensure the salmon is cooked to 145˚F for perfect doneness.
  • Adding a drizzle of honey to the mayo mix can enhance the tangy glaze for those who enjoy a touch of sweetness.

Variations and Substitutions

  • Spices: Swap paprika for smoked paprika for a deeper, smoky flavor.
  • Mayonnaise Substitute: Use Greek yogurt or sour cream for a lighter glaze.
  • Lemon Alternative: Replace lemon slices with orange or lime for a citrus twist.

FAQs

Q: Can I use frozen salmon?
A: Yes, thaw the salmon completely and pat it dry before seasoning and baking.

Q: How do I know when the salmon is cooked?
A: The salmon is done when it flakes easily with a fork and reaches an internal temperature of 145˚F.

Q: Can I use skinless salmon?
A: Yes, skinless salmon works just as well for this recipe.

Serving Suggestions

  • Pair with steamed asparagus or roasted vegetables for a healthy, balanced meal.
  • Serve over a bed of fluffy rice or quinoa for a filling main course.
  • Add a side of garlic mashed potatoes for a comforting, hearty option.
